Transaction 62f0f6cfb1a90b62fc772b8dd43f7c23bfb45a74667bce88c8d002b16029bec8
1 Input
1 Outputs
- 62f0f6cfb1a90b62fc772b8dd43f7c23bfb45a74667bce88c8d002b16029bec8:0
value 1432110
address 1Gf5fsuKARjLYxHEVR8oZk2yWuVbFkkRhH